Search by job, company or skills

Synechron Technologies Private Limited

Lead Big Data

8-10 Years

This job is no longer accepting applications

new job description bg glownew job description bg glownew job description bg svg
  • Posted 2 months ago

Job Description

Job description

  • Translate application storyboards and use cases into functional applications.
  • Design, build, and maintain efficient, reusable, and reliable Java code.
  • Ensure the best possible performance, quality, and responsiveness of the applications.
  • Identify bottlenecks and bugs, and devise solutions to these problems.
  • Develop high performance & low latency components to run Spark clusters.
  • Interpreting functional requirements into design approaches those can be served through Big Data platform.
  • Collaborate and partner with Global Teams based across different locations.
  • Be able to propose best practices and standards; handover to the operations.
  • Perform the testing of software prototypes and transfer to the operational team.
  • Processing of data using Hive, Impala & HBASE.
  • Performing analysis of large data sets and derive insight.

Skills required

  • Solid understanding of object-oriented programming and design pattern.
  • 8+ Years of strong Java experience with Java 1.8 or higher version.
  • Comfortable working with large data volumes and be able to demonstrate a firm understanding of logical data structures and analysis techniques Capable of assisting with the design of solutions and mentoring other developers within the same team Strong Core Java & Multithreading working experience
  • Experience in Big data technologies like HDFS, Hive. HBASE, Apache Spark & Kafka Experience in building self-service platform agnostic data access apis Service oriented architecture, and data standards like JSON, Avro, Parquet
  • Experience in building advanced analytical models based on business context Agile/Scrum methodology experience is required. Experience in SCMs like GIT; and tools like JIRA Strong systems analysis, design and architecture fundamentals, Unit Testing and other SDLC activities
  • Experience in working on Linux shell scripting
  • Experience in RDMS and No SQL databases
  • Demonstrated analytical and problem-solving skills. -
  • Application performance tuning, troubleshooting experience and the implementation of these skills in Big Data domain. Ability to write reliable, manageable, and high-performance code
  • Good knowledge of database principles, practices, structures including SQL development experience preferably with Oracle. Knowledge of concurrency patterns & multithreading in Java.
  • Familiarity with concepts of Domain Design, JDBC, and RESTful. Understanding fundamental design principles behind a scalable application.
  • Proficient understanding of code versioning tools, such as Git. Basic Unix OS and scripting knowledge.

More Info

Job Type:
Function:
Employment Type:
Open to candidates from:
Indian

About Company

At Synechron, we believe in the power of digital to transform businesses for the better. Our global consulting firm combines creativity and innovative technology to deliver industry-leading digital solutions. Synechron’s progressive technologies and optimization strategies span end-to-end Artificial Intelligence, Consulting, Digital, Cloud & DevOps, Data, and Software Engineering, servicing an array of noteworthy financial services and technology firms. Through research and development initiatives in our FinLabs, we develop solutions for modernization, from Artificial Intelligence and Blockchain to Data Science models, Digital Underwriting, mobile-first applications, and more. Over the last 20+ years, our company has been honored with multiple employer awards, recognizing our commitment to our talented teams. With top clients to boast about, Synechron has a global workforce of 14,500+, and has 48 offices in 19 countries within key global markets.

Job ID: 104666291